Report: Gordon Hayward Expected to Miss Multiple Weeks with Grade 3 Ankle Sprain
The Boston Celtics announced forward Gordon Hayward suffered a grade 3 ankle sprain in Monday’s series opening victory against the 76ers. Hayward underwent an MRI following the game, which revealed the severity of the sprain.
